About this trip

The Coast Starlight connects Seattle and Burbank directly, with no transfer required. The train operates daily, and the segment between these two stations is one of 121 origin-destination pairs we catalog on this route.

Coverage of approximately 1,275 rail miles takes about 25h 40m on a typical schedule. Actual travel time varies with the specific train number, time of day, equipment used, and seasonal speed restrictions. Trains may run faster on the daylight schedules and slower at peak demand on shared-use trackage. Things to look out for: Pacific coastline north of San Luis Obispo through Vandenberg Air Force Base — a stretch of beach unreachable by road; Cascade Mountains around Klamath Falls.

Fares and ticketing

One-way fares between Seattle and Burbank typically run between $110 and $569. The lower end represents Saver-bucket advance-purchase coach fares, while the upper end approximates same-day walk-up fares or premium-class buckets. Sleeping car accommodations on overnight runs of the Coast Starlight, when offered, are sold separately from rail fare and increase total ticket cost substantially.
